2 R hyt hm C ondi t i on Pages
T he R hythm C ondition includes the follow ing tw o pages: the R hythm
C ondition page used to adjust the rhythm s and the Instrum ent page
used to m ake up each drum / percussion instrum ent, each of w hich
com prises the rhythm s and is playable using the K eyboard Percussion
function.
1) T o sel ect t he R hyt hm C ondi t i on page:
C hoose a rhyt hm , and press t hat pat t ernユs panel but t on agai n (or agai n press
t he D at a C ont rol but t on correspondi ng t o t he sel ect ed rhyt hm ). (T he but t on
shoul d be pressed onl y once i f t he R hyt hm di spl ay has al ready been cal l ed up;
ot herw i se press t he but t on t w i ce. )
R hyt hm C ondi t i on Page
1 A U T O V A R I. (A ut o V ari at i on)
The A ut o V ari at i on funct i on l et s you set pat t ern vari at i ons t o be pl ayed
aut om at i cal l y. W hen set t o O N , A ut o V ari at i on aut om at i cal l y subst i t ut es
addi t i onal pat t ern vari at i ons t o m ake t he rhyt hm m ore i nt erest i ng and
com pl ex.
2 PE R C U SSIO N R E V . (R everb)
D eterm ines the am ount of reverb applied to the rhythm s and
percussi on sounds used i n t he rhyt hm s. W hen t he panel R E V E R B
cont rol i s set t o t he m i ni m um , t he set t i ng here w i l l have no effect .
R ange: 0-24
(See page 54 for t he det ai l ed i nform at i on on t he R everb effect . )
3 PE R C U SSIO N B A L . (B al ance)
D et erm i nes t he bal ance bet w een t w o m ai n sound t ypes of t he rhyt hm s:
t he drum sounds and t he cym bal sounds. H i gher set t i ngs em phasi ze
t he cym bal sounds, w hi l e l ow er set t i ngs em phasi ze t he drum s.
4 PE R C U SSIO N V O L . (V ol um e)
Fi ne adj ust m ent of t he overal l vol um e of t he rhyt hm s and K eyboard
Percussi on (page 71).
5 A C C . V O L . (A ccom pani m ent V ol um e)
(T hi s cont rol i s t he sam e as t hat descri bed i n t he A ccom pani m ent
sect i on, page 70. )
